Definitions from Wikipedia (UNIFAC)
▸ noun: In statistical thermodynamics, the UNIFAC method (UNIQUAC Functional-group Activity Coefficients)Aage Fredenslund, Russell L. Jones and John M. Prausnitz, "Group-Contribution Estimation of Activity Coefficients in Nonideal Liquid Mixtures", AIChE Journal, vol. 21, p. 1086 is a semi-empirical system for the prediction of non-electrolyte activity in non-ideal mixtures.
